Jacob Bissaillon

Chief Executive Officer | jbissaillon@justiceassistance.org

Jake Bissaillon serves as the Chief Executive Officer of Justice Assistance. He is an experienced advocate and administrator with a deep history of leadership in both state and local government. Jake earned his Bachelor of Arts and Master’s in Business Administration from Providence College as well as a Juris Doctorate from Roger Williams University School of Law.

Prior to working for Justice Assistance, Jake served as the Chief of Staff for Rhode Island Senate, developing and negotiating Senate leadership’s legislative agenda from 2021 to 2023. His past public sector experience also includes serving as legal counsel to former Senate Majority Leader Michael J. McCaffrey and as the Chief of Staff to the Providence City Council under Council President Michael A. Solomon. Jake joined Justice Assistance in 2023.

During his time in various leadership positions, Jake played a pivotal role in advancing significant legislation impacting Rhode Island’s criminal justice system. These include comprehensive changes to the state’s sentencing guidelines known as “Justice Reinvestment” in 2017, “Fair Chance Licensing” reform, and expungement reform. Jake also played a crucial role in enacting common-sense gun safety laws, establishing a $15 minimum wage, issuing child tax credits to support Rhode Island families, and implementing tax relief measures for seniors, families, and small businesses.

Born in Merrimac, Massachusetts, Jake came to Rhode Island to attend Providence College. He resides in Providence's Elmhurst neighborhood with his wife, Kim, and their two dogs, Winnie and Winston. Jake currently represents District One (Providence) in the Rhode Island Senate.
